在现代教育体系中,课程教学时间表的合理安排对于提高教学效率、保证教学质量具有重要意义。精准排期不仅能够帮助教师更好地规划教学活动,还能让学生提前了解学习进度,调整学习计划。本文将深入探讨课程教学时间表预测的艺术,分析其重要性、预测方法以及在实际应用中的挑战。

一、课程教学时间表预测的重要性

  1. 优化教学资源分配:通过预测,学校可以合理分配教师、教室等教学资源,避免资源浪费。
  2. 提高教学效率:精准的时间安排有助于教师和学生合理规划时间,提高教学和学习效率。
  3. 满足学生个性化需求:预测可以帮助教师根据学生的不同需求调整教学计划,实现个性化教学。
  4. 提高教学质量:合理安排时间表有助于教师深入挖掘课程内容,提高教学质量。

二、课程教学时间表预测的方法

  1. 历史数据分析:通过对历史教学时间表的数据进行分析,找出规律和趋势,为预测提供依据。 “`python import pandas as pd

# 假设有一个包含历史教学时间表的数据集 data = pd.read_csv(‘historical_teaching_schedule.csv’)

# 分析数据,找出规律 data[‘average_duration’] = data[‘duration’].mean() print(data)


2. **专家经验法**:邀请具有丰富教学经验的教师参与预测,结合他们的经验和直觉进行判断。
3. **机器学习方法**:利用机器学习算法,如时间序列分析、回归分析等,对教学时间表进行预测。
   ```python
   from sklearn.linear_model import LinearRegression
   import numpy as np

   # 假设有一个包含教学时间表和影响因素的数据集
   X =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
   y = np.array([1, 2, 3])

   # 创建线性回归模型
   model = LinearRegression()
   model.fit(X, y)

   # 预测
   predicted = model.predict([[10, 11, 12]])
   print(predicted)
  1. 模拟仿真法:通过模拟教学过程中的各种因素,预测时间表的变化。

三、实际应用中的挑战

  1. 数据质量:预测的准确性依赖于数据质量,数据缺失或不准确会影响预测结果。
  2. 模型适用性:不同的预测方法适用于不同的情况,需要根据实际情况选择合适的模型。
  3. 人为因素:教师和学生的主观因素也会影响时间表的预测和实施。

四、总结

课程教学时间表预测是一门艺术,它需要结合历史数据、专家经验、机器学习等方法,以实现精准排期。在实际应用中,我们需要不断优化预测方法,提高预测的准确性,为教师和学生提供更好的教学和学习体验。